The Four Pillars


BPL has long supported causes our people care about. BPL Impact takes that commitment further, putting greater structure around our charitable giving efforts.

At the centre of the strategy are four pillars, shaped by the priorities of our colleagues and reviewed through our employee-led Charity Committee. These pillars offer a framework to help us direct our support to areas where the need is acute, the impact is measurable, and the scope to partner is long-term.

Social Empowerment & Inclusion

Supporting those at the edges of society, from people facing homelessness to survivors of modern slavery.

Humanitarian Response & Resilience

Funding practical solutions in response to conflict, natural disasters, and urgent humanitarian needs.

Environmental Protection

Backing efforts to reduce environmental harm and protect vulnerable communities from climate impacts.

Health & Wellbeing

And funding initiatives that support health and wellbeing, from treatment and prevention to awareness.

More than one way to make an impact

With BPL Impact, our support extends beyond funding. While donations remain central, we also offer our time, space and visibility to charities. It’s a more rounded approach, designed to build lasting relationships and help our partners maximise their impact.

We provide financial support to our partners, prioritising multi-year commitments wherever possible. This allows charities to plan, grow and deliver with fewer short-term pressures.

Colleagues are given the opportunity to contribute directly. Three paid volunteer days are available each year to support charities across our – or their own – network.

We offer match funding to boost our employees’ fundraising, multiplying individual efforts.

We open our offices to our charity partners for use in their own workshops, launches and events.

We encourage our colleagues to take up ambassador or trustee positions at charities whose missions resonate most with them.

We seek to elevate the incredible work of our charity partners wherever possible, whether that’s through networking or making introductions, or promoting their efforts via our own communications channels, to help raise awareness of what they do.

Headline partners

Three headline charity partners will receive funding through this new strategy, as part of an overall commitment under BPL Impact to give £1.2 million over the next three years. Each charity has been selected based on its alignment with one or more of our four pillars, and the impact our partnership has already had, reflecting the kind of relationship we want to build: long-term, purposeful and grounded in trust.

We See Hope

WeSeeHope

WeSeeHope partners with community-based organisations in Eastern and Southern Africa to help vulnerable children and families build secure, sustainable futures. BPL has supported the charity for many years, and a new three-year funding commitment is helping scale its programmes and deepen long-term impact.
East End Foundation

East End Foundation

East End Community Foundation works at the heart of East London, tackling the issues that matter most to local communities, from youth opportunity to digital inclusion and isolation. BPL has supported the Foundation through its Life Chances campaign, helping connect corporate giving to long-term, locally-led change.
Insulate Ukraine

Insulate Ukraine

Insulate Ukraine develops low-cost, fast-to-install insulated window systems that make war-damaged homes liveable again. BPL was the charity’s first corporate donor and remains a founding partner, supporting its growth from early prototype to national impact.
